MCP公式ドキュメント 日本語版
  1. 始める
MCP公式ドキュメント 日本語版
  • 始める
    • 導入
    • サンプルサーバー
    • クライアントの例
    • クイックスタート
      • サーバー開発者向け
      • クライアント開発者向け
      • Claude デスクトップ ユーザー向け
  • チュートリアル
    • LLMs を使用した MCP の構築
    • デバッグ
    • Inspector
  • コンセプト
    • リソース
    • コアアーキテクチャ
    • プロンプト
    • ツール
    • サンプリング
    • ルーツ
    • トランスポート
  • 発達
    • 最新情報
    • ロードマップ
    • 貢献
  1. 始める

導入

Model Context Protocol (MCP) の開始
Java SDK がリリースされました。その他の新機能もご確認ください。
MCP は、アプリケーションが LLMs にコンテキストを提供する方法を標準化するオープン プロトコルです。MCP は、AI アプリケーション用の USB-C ポートのようなものです。USB-C がデバイスをさまざまな周辺機器やアクセサリに接続するための標準化された方法を提供するのと同様に、MCP は AI モデルをさまざまなデータ ソースやツールに接続するための標準化された方法を提供します。

なぜMCPなのか?#

MCP は、LLMs 上にエージェントと複雑なワークフローを構築するのに役立ちます。LLMs は頻繁にデータやツールとの統合を必要としますが、MCP は次の機能を提供します。
LLMに直接接続できる、あらかじめ構築された統合のリストが増えています
LLM プロバイダーとベンダー間を切り替える柔軟性
インフラストラクチャ内でデータを保護するためのベストプラクティス

一般的なアーキテクチャ#

MCP は基本的に、ホスト アプリケーションが複数のサーバーに接続できるクライアント サーバー アーキテクチャに従います。
image.png
MCP ホスト: Claude Desktop、IDE、または MCP を介してデータにアクセスする AI ツールなどのプログラム
MCP クライアント: サーバーとの 1:1 接続を維持するプロトコル クライアント
MCP サーバー: 標準化されたモデル コンテキスト プロトコルを通じて特定の機能を公開する軽量プログラム
ローカル データ ソース: MCP サーバーが安全にアクセスできるコンピューターのファイル、データベース、サービス
リモートサービス: MCP サーバーが接続できるインターネット経由 (API 経由など) で利用可能な外部システム

サポートとフィードバック#

ヘルプを受けたりフィードバックを提供したりする方法は次のとおりです。
MCP仕様、SDK、ドキュメント(オープンソース)に関するバグレポートや機能リクエストについては、 GitHubの問題を作成してください。
MCP仕様に関する議論やQ&Aについては、仕様に関する議論をご利用ください。
他のMCPオープンソースコンポーネントに関するディスカッションやQ&Aについては、組織のディスカッションをご利用ください。
Claude.app と claude.ai の MCP 統合に関するバグ報告、機能リクエスト、質問については、 mcp-support@anthropic.comまでメールでお問い合わせください。
次へ
サンプルサーバー
Built with